Description

Tecnova Electronics Inc. is seeking a self-motivated Quality Inspector who can accurately perform quality inspections of electronic assemblies, including printed circuit board assemblies.

Candidates must have the ability to:

  • Operate AOI machine
  • Rework PCB assemblies
  • Contribute and work in a team environment
  • Distinguish colors, fine circuit detail, and tones
  • Inspect products under magnification for extended periods of time
  • Comprehend and perform duties in accordance with an ISO9001 Quality System

Requirements

Applicants must meet the following criteria:

  • High School diploma or equivalent
  • 2 years inspection experience in an electronics manufacturing environment
  • Knowledge of IPC standards, preferred
  • Electronic component identification
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Word and Excel
  • Excellent organizational skills, problem solving techniques, and accuracy are essential
  • Excellent communication skills
  • Must be able to manually lift up to 30 pounds
